A Course Management System (CMS) is a digital tool that helps educational institutions manage their training courses, integrate with student and faculty systems, and facilitate communication. It provides dashboards for school management, staff, students, and parents, allowing users to upload assignments, view schedules, and track progress. Additionally, the CMS can utilize artificial intelligence for analytics and links to third-party marketplaces to sell courses and enhance engagement through blogs and social media.